When your AC breaks down unexpectedly, it’s tempting to jump into DIY fixes or hire the cheapest technician you can find. However, quick decisions made in the heat of the moment can lead to costly mistakes down the road. Here are five common pitfalls to avoid during emergency AC repairs: 1. DIY Fixes: While tackling small home repairs yourself can be empowering, AC repairs often require specialized knowledge and tools. Attempting a DIY fix without proper training can worsen the problem or even cause injury. 2. Hiring Unqualified Technicians: In an emergency, it’s tempting to hire the first available technician. However, unqualified technicians may lack the expertise to properly diagnose and repair your AC, leading to recurring issues and higher costs. 3. Neglecting Regular Maintenance: Preventative maintenance is key to avoiding emergency AC repairs. Neglecting regular tune-ups and filter changes can cause your AC to work harder, leading to breakdowns when you need it most. 4. Ignoring Warning Signs: Pay attention to any unusual noises, smells, or performance issues with your AC. Ignoring these warning signs can allow small problems to escalate into major breakdowns. 5. Delaying Repairs: Putting off necessary AC repairs can exacerbate the issue, leading to more extensive and expensive repairs down the road. Address AC problems promptly to prevent further damage and expense.
